Delingpole on BBC This Week (Jan. 2018)

James Delingpole on the Trump Presidency:

Donald Trump is “amazing” claims James Delingpole looking at the first year of his presidency. In a personal film for This Week, he asks: “Is President Donald Trump really an idiot? Well if he is, he is the luckiest idiot in presidential history”